WSG Gallery is proud to present a pop-up show of the gallery artists’ work at 401 N Ann Arbor St. in Saline, MI, September 25 - October 2. WSG Gallery represents Michigan artists and specializes in connecting collectors with paintings, sculpture, woodcut and intaglio prints, book arts and works on paper.
The pop-up gallery will be open Friday, September 25, 4-6pm, Saturday, September 26, 12-6pm, and Sunday, September 27, 12-4pm. Masks are required to enter and the number of people admitted will be limited to allow for social distancing.
The pop-up gallery will be open for private appointments through October 2. Plenty of free parking is located behind the building. Visit WSG Gallery’s Facebook page for timely information or contact us through the website: www.wsg-art.com
